Man found shot near St Gregory and Hatch Streets, Cincinnati OH


A man was found shot and lying in the street near St Gregory and Hatch Streets in Cincinnati. Three gunshots were heard. Police and emergency services responded. The suspect fled toward Central Parkway through nearby woods.
